Microsoft DB2OLEDB Provider Stops Responding Under Stress

SYMPTOMS

When you call a COM object very frequently (that is, more than 10 times per second) in an environment that includes the following:

  • A BizTalk server that is using Windows 2000 Server Service Pack 2 and that is running orchestration processes
  • A COM+ application server that is using Windows 2000 Server Service Pack 1 and that is running multiple COM applications, each of which is using the DB2OLEDB Provider
  • A SQL server that is using Windows 2000 Server Service Pack 1

the server may stop responding (hang). A debug of the hang may show a stack trace that resembles the following:

RESOLUTION

To resolve this problem, obtain the latest service pack for Host Integration Server 2000. For additional information, click the following article number to view the article in the Microsoft Knowledge Base:

STATUS

Microsoft has confirmed that this is a problem in Microsoft Host Integration Server 2000. This problem was first corrected in Host Integration Server 2000 Service Pack 1.
